Understanding Diabetes: A Silent Threat
Diabetes is fundamentally a condition where your body struggles to regulate blood sugar levels effectively. Normally, the hormone insulin acts as a key, unlocking your cells to absorb sugar from your bloodstream for energy. However, when diabetes develops, this delicate system breaks down. Either your pancreas ceases producing insulin entirely, which is characteristic of Type 1 diabetes, or your cells become resistant to insulin’s effects, a condition known as Type 2 diabetes. In both scenarios, sugar accumulates in your blood, eventually causing irreversible damage to your vital organs, blood vessels, and nerves over time. Since Type 2 diabetes is by far the more prevalent form, understanding its early indicators becomes particularly vital for public health.
Type 1 vs. Type 2 Diabetes: The Core Differences
While both forms of diabetes result in elevated blood sugar, their underlying mechanisms and typical onset differ significantly. Type 1 diabetes, often diagnosed in children and young adults, is an autoimmune condition where the body mistakenly attacks and destroys the insulin-producing cells in the pancreas. This means the body produces little to no insulin. In contrast, Type 2 diabetes usually develops gradually, often in adulthood, where the body either doesn’t produce enough insulin or, more commonly, becomes resistant to the insulin it does produce. Lifestyle factors, genetics, and age frequently play roles in the development of Type 2 diabetes, making it a condition that often presents with more subtle, slower-developing symptoms compared to the rapid onset of Type 1.

The Vicious Cycle of Frequent Urination and Thirst
One of the hallmark early signs of diabetes is polyuria, or frequent urination, particularly noticeable at night. This occurs because elevated blood sugar levels force your kidneys to work overtime, trying to filter and reabsorb the excess glucose. At a certain point, they simply cannot keep up with this demand. Consequently, excess glucose spills into your urine, dragging significant amounts of water along with it. This increased fluid loss not only leads to more frequent trips to the bathroom but also induces a persistent state of dehydration, prompting excessive thirst. Unfortunately, hydrating with sugary beverages like juice or soda exacerbates this cycle, feeding the very problem it attempts to solve.
Visible Clues on Your Skin: Acanthosis Nigricans and Skin Tags
Your skin can often reveal deeper health issues, including insulin resistance, a precursor to Type 2 diabetes. Acanthosis nigricans, for instance, appears as dark, velvety patches on the skin, most commonly found on the back of the neck, in the armpits, or the groin area. This phenomenon signifies that your cells are becoming less responsive to normal insulin levels. In response, your pancreas increases insulin production, and these elevated insulin levels then stimulate growth factors in the skin cells, particularly in high-friction areas. This stimulation leads to the characteristic thickening and hyperpigmentation seen in acanthosis nigricans, making it a visible alert that your body’s sugar management system is under strain.
Furthermore, small, benign skin growths known as skin tags can also signal potential insulin resistance. These tiny flaps of skin commonly emerge in areas where skin rubs together, such as the neck, armpits, and groin. While generally harmless on their own, the presence of multiple skin tags often correlates with higher insulin levels, suggesting that the body is working harder to process glucose. Both acanthosis nigricans and numerous skin tags, when observed together or individually, warrant a discussion with your healthcare provider about underlying metabolic health.
Why Infections Become More Common
High blood sugar creates an ideal environment for various microorganisms, including bacteria and fungi, to flourish. Elevated glucose levels essentially provide a constant food source, promoting their rapid growth and spread throughout the body. Moreover, persistently high blood sugar significantly compromises your immune system, making your body less capable of fighting off invaders. This weakened defense mechanism often manifests as recurrent skin infections, such as abscesses or persistent yeast infections. However, the impact extends beyond the skin. The excess glucose in the urine also increases the likelihood of urinary tract infections, affecting both men and women due to the sugary environment in the urinary system.

Diabetic Cheiroarthropathy: The Stiff Hand Syndrome
Did you know that elevated blood glucose can literally coat your tendons in sugar? This process, known as glycosylation, involves sugar molecules binding to proteins in your tissues, including the collagen in your skin and tendons. This “sugar coating” makes these soft tissues thicker and less flexible, severely limiting their range of movement. A common manifestation of this is diabetic cheiroarthropathy, or diabetic stiff hand syndrome. You can test for this yourself: place your palms together as if in prayer. If your fingers cannot fully straighten, or your palms do not completely touch, this “positive prayer sign” could indicate this condition. Clinically, this stiffness can sometimes be mistaken for arthritis, yet the underlying issue resides in the sugar-coated connective tissues rather than joint inflammation or degradation.
Trigger Finger and Frozen Shoulder: Hidden Joint Impacts
The same glycosylation process that causes stiff hands can also lead to other painful joint issues. Trigger finger occurs when a tendon responsible for bending your finger becomes inflamed and develops a nodule or thickens, preventing it from gliding smoothly through its sheath. Patients often experience their finger getting ‘stuck’ in a bent position, then snapping straight with effort, hence the name. Similarly, adhesive capsulitis, commonly known as frozen shoulder, can also be triggered or exacerbated by diabetes. This condition causes immense pain and stiffness in the shoulder joint, potentially lasting for years. In both instances, high blood sugar impairs the normal function and flexibility of tendons and connective tissues, highlighting another hidden impact of diabetes.
Neuropathy: When Nerves Lose Their Sensation
Diabetes can profoundly damage your nerves, a condition termed neuropathy. High blood sugar is directly toxic to nerve cells and also harms the tiny blood vessels that supply oxygen and nutrients to these nerves. As nerves deteriorate, you might experience sensations like numbness, tingling, or burning pain, predominantly in the hands and feet. This loss of sensation, particularly in the feet, poses significant dangers. Individuals with diabetic neuropathy might not feel minor injuries, such as cuts or blisters, leading to unhealed wounds. The altered sensation also changes walking mechanics, leading to abnormal pressure distribution and microtraumas—tiny bone fractures—that go unnoticed. Without proper healing, these injuries can escalate dramatically.
The Devastating Path to Charcot Foot and Amputations
The unchecked progression of diabetic neuropathy, coupled with compromised blood flow and weakened immunity, can lead to severe structural changes in the foot, known as Charcot foot. This condition involves the progressive destruction of bones and soft tissues in the foot, often resulting in a collapsed arch and a distinctive “rocker bottom” appearance. The frightening aspect is that many individuals with Charcot foot report little to no pain, a testament to the extensive nerve damage present. This lack of sensation, combined with poor healing and increased infection risk, unfortunately makes diabetes the number one cause of non-traumatic amputations globally. Regular daily inspection of the feet for any cuts, blisters, or nail problems becomes an essential preventative measure for anyone living with diabetes.
Digestive Disruptions: Gastroparesis Explained
Beyond the extremities, diabetes can also impact the digestive system, specifically leading to a condition called gastroparesis. This occurs when damage to the nerves supplying the stomach causes it to empty food more slowly than normal. Symptoms can include bloating, nausea, vomiting, and a feeling of fullness after eating only small amounts. Gastroparesis presents significant challenges for meal planning and can make managing blood glucose levels particularly difficult, as the delayed and unpredictable absorption of carbohydrates leads to erratic sugar fluctuations. Addressing this requires careful dietary adjustments and potentially medication to help regulate stomach emptying.
Demystifying Diabetes Diagnosis: The A1c Test
Fortunately, diagnosing diabetes has become much more refined than historical methods. Today, the most reliable and common test is the hemoglobin A1c. This test provides an average of your blood sugar levels over the past two to three months, offering a comprehensive picture that single-moment blood glucose readings cannot. Like your tendons, the hemoglobin protein in your red blood cells undergoes glycosylation when exposed to sugar. The higher your average blood sugar, the more sugar attaches to your hemoglobin. By measuring this “sugar-coated” hemoglobin, doctors gain insight into your long-term glucose control. An A1c reading of 6.5% or higher is indicative of diabetes, while readings between 5.7% and 6.4% suggest prediabetes, a crucial window for intervention.
Who Should Get Tested for Diabetes?
If you experience any of the symptoms discussed above, seeking immediate testing is highly recommended. For the general population, guidelines from organizations like the American Diabetes Association suggest that everyone should have their hemoglobin A1c checked at least every three years, starting at age 35. However, if you possess any risk factors—such as a family history of diabetes, obesity, a sedentary lifestyle, high blood pressure, or a history of gestational diabetes—it is advisable to begin testing earlier or more frequently. Early testing can catch prediabetes, offering a critical opportunity to make lifestyle changes and potentially prevent the onset of full-blown diabetes.
Proactive Steps: Preventing Diabetes Naturally
While genetics and other factors play a role, many instances of Type 2 diabetes are preventable or significantly delayed through diligent lifestyle modifications. Taking charge of your health today can drastically reduce your risk. These fundamental principles offer a powerful framework for prevention:
- Dietary Choices: Focus on a diet rich in high-fiber foods, such as whole grains, fruits, and vegetables. Prioritize complex carbohydrates, which release sugar into your bloodstream more gradually, preventing sudden spikes. Significantly reduce your intake of added sugars and highly processed foods, which contribute to rapid blood sugar increases and weight gain.
- Regular Exercise: Incorporate both cardiovascular activity and strength training into your weekly routine. Cardiovascular exercises, like brisk walking or cycling, improve insulin sensitivity and help burn calories. Strength training builds muscle mass, which also aids in glucose metabolism. Aim for at least 150 minutes of moderate-intensity aerobic activity and two or more days of strength training per week.
- Maintain a Healthy Weight: Excess body fat, particularly around the abdomen, is a significant risk factor for insulin resistance. Losing even a modest amount of weight can substantially lower your risk of developing Type 2 diabetes. Combine healthy eating with regular physical activity to achieve and maintain a healthy body weight.
- Quit Smoking: Smoking profoundly increases your risk of developing diabetes and exacerbates its complications. Toxins in cigarette smoke can damage cells and increase inflammation, leading to insulin resistance. Quitting smoking is one of the most impactful steps you can take for overall health and diabetes prevention.
